Deadlines for GCL are quickly approaching! Register today for GCL Germany, Australia, Ireland or Hong Kong
Register now to secure your spot! AIPT & IAESTE United States are
excited to announce new opportunities for U.S. students to travel
abroad! Choose from 4 different program countries for Global Career
Launch (GCL) 2010, including: Germany, Australia, Ireland and Hong Kong.

GCL Germany and Australia Here
is your chance to explore future career and academic opportunities
while discovering all that Germany or Australia has to offer during a
10-day program in Munich or an 11-day program in Sydney. Meet with
human resources representatives at companies that hire international
graduates as well as admissions representatives at top technical
universities in each country to discuss post-graduate options. This is
a one of a kind opportunity to get your foot in the door with a leading
international company. GCL Germany and GCL Australia will each include: -Program orientation -International airfare from a selected gateway city -Accommodations for the duration of the trip -In-country transportation -Cultural activities -Health and accident insurance GCL Germany Dates: May 21 - May 30 Cost: $3500 (including airfare from selected U.S. gateway city) GCL Australia Dates: May 20 - May 30 Cost: $3700 (including airfare from selected U.S. gateway city) Both programs are open to students attending a U.S. university and who are studying an engineering/technical major.
_________________________________________________

GCL Ireland and Hong Kong Don't
miss a great opportunity to do an internship abroad with GCL Ireland
and GCL Hong Kong. Spend 8 weeks in Ireland or Hong Kong where you will
complete an unpaid internship with a local business that is directly
related to your major. You will also explore the culture and beauty of
the country through informal classes, pre-arranged cultural activities
and free weekends to travel. GCL Ireland and GCL Hong Kong will each include: -Internship placement in your field of study -Housing for the duration of the program -Health and accident insurance -Pre-departure support from AIPT -Orientation with tours -Organized cultural activities -Free weekends for travel GCL Ireland Dates: June 3 - July 31 Cost: $4000 + roundtrip airfare GCL Hong Kong Dates: June 15 - August 6 Cost: $4000 + roundtrip airfare Both programs are open to students attending a U.S. university and who are studying any major.

The International IAESTE Day ( http://www.iaesteday.com/) was first organized in six countries in 2005. It can serve as an annual occasion for the global promotion of IAESTE as well as for the continuation and the establishment of good relationships with companies, universities and students.

Deal IAESTE UH Members IAESTE University of Houston is inviting you to 2009 IAESTE Central Regional Conference. Regional conferences allow IAESTE members from each of the four regions to share experiences, network, and elect the regional representative. The host universities have the opportunity to demonstrate organizational and leadership abilities, while introducing fellow IAESTE members to their school. The Fall Regional Conferences are an excellent opportunity to train new members, learn more about IAESTE, and create cohesive regions full of IAESTE spirit! Receive $750 travel grant to attend IAESTE JUMP international conference in Austria!The
JUMP Conference brings together IAESTE members from across the globe in
order to share IAESTE knowledge, broaden the IAESTE network, motivate
members, and make connections with peers from around the world. During
the conference, participants engage in interactive IAESTE-related
working groups and participate in various site visits and social
activities.
This year, this international conference will be held in Radstadt,
Austria from September 30 - October 4. More information about the JUMP
Conference can be found at http://www.jump.iaeste.at/.
IAESTE United States is offering two $750 travel reimbursement grants
to help students interested in attending cover the costs of travel to
JUMP. In order to be considered for the JUMP Travel Grant, interested
individuals must complete the attached application and email it back to
iaeste@aipt.org by Monday August 31. (Please copy us, the UH local committee at iaeste@uh.edu
for any questions or all communications related to the attendance)
Please note that registration for JUMP is not limited to just the two
U.S. recipients of the travel grant; any member of IAESTE United States
is eligible to attend regardless of whether they receive the Grant. |
